On the latest episode of Sister Wives , Kody reflected on his three failed marriages and saved his harshest comments for ex-wife Meri.

Kody and Meri Brown are no longer an item. (TLC)

For example, after discovering that Mery had gone to church to ask for a formal “release” from their spiritual union, Brown admitted that their romance lacked “a lot of intelligence,” and added in a mean-spirited aside:

“When we got married I had no idea who she was. She was very different.

“I think Meri had some baggage that I wasn’t aware of initially. I thought I could live with it … I couldn’t live in a world where she was constantly angry at me.”

Kody and Meri exchanged wedding vows in 1994, but they divorced in 2010 so that Kody could marry Robyn Brown and legally adopt her children from her previous marriage.

However, the pair stayed together, although they stopped sleeping together and eventually split in January 2023.

Kody then said that he didn’t agree with Meri’s decision to go to church, explaining that “the damage was done” and that he “didn’t want to be accountable to this church and all of their bullshit.”

The self-centered father of 17 children further explained that “when a person is already married, he has no choice,” when he is part of a polygamous family.

“In polygamy, if he wants to stay faithful and in the faith, he can’t ask for a divorce,” Kody said. “It’s not allowed. So I couldn’t get out of that relationship.”
